Apple Mac OS 8 was another major overhaul of the OS from the earlier Mac OS 7. It added a new Platinum visual theme, a multi threaded Finder, better virtual memory, and many customization options. 8.5 and later require a PPC CPU. It was followed up by Mac OS 9.

Running MacOS 8 requires a supported Motorola 68K or Power PC based Macintosh (see the compatibility matrix), or one of the following emulators:
Basilisk II - Runs MacOS 7.x-8.1, emulates later color Motorola 68k based Macs.
SheepShaver - Runs MacOS 7.5.2-9.0.4, emulates a Power PC based Macintosh.

Mac OS 8.5 and later require a PowerPC based Macintosh. This version drops support for all m68k CPU based Macintosh computers.

Emulation notes: To run MacOS 8.5 on newer hardware, we recommend the SheepShaver emulator, which emulates a PowerPC Macintosh.
